Political factions in the legislature engaged in a war of words on the fuel price increase. Golkar and PKS were duplicitous, and the government's chance to raise prices remains open.

An hour behind schedule, a meeting of coalition party representatives held at the office of the Joint Coalition Secretariat on Monday last week, began at 8pm. The meeting was led by Secretary of the Joint Secretariat Syariefuddin Hasan, a Democrat Party politician who is also the Cooperatives and Small/Medium Enterprises minister.
